Welcome to Girls on the Run of Maricopa County! We are a
life-changing, non-profit prevention program that inspires girls in
3rd through 8th grade to be joyful, healthy and confident using a
fun, experience-based curriculum which creatively integrates
running.
Girls on the RunĀ® combines training for a 5K event with healthy
living education. Our 12-week curricula address all aspects
of girls' development - their physical, emotional, mental, social
and spiritual well-being.
We use exercise, positive reinforcement, and encouraging role
models to help girls discover the confidence they need in those
critical pre-teen years and beyond. Through interactive activities
such as running, playing games and discussing important issues,
participants learn how to celebrate being their unique and real
selves, how to be part of a team and how to positively contribute
to their community. Our hope is that every girl believes and can
say, "I belong just the way I am."

Girls on the Run of Maricopa County is an Independent Council
of Girls on the Run
International, which has a network of over 186 locations across the United States and
Canada. We are a non-profit 501(c)(3) organization funded by
participant fees, private and corporate donations, sponsorships and
grants. The program is fee-based, however financial
assistance is available to ensure the program is accessible to all
who are interested. The generosity of donors and our
fantastic volunteers enables us to fulfill our mission and reach
more and more girls in Maricopa County.
